Therapeutic Approaches That Translate Well to Online Care
Mary N Coniglio draws from approaches that help clients reconnect with what matters most and make practical, values-aligned changes. Client-Centered Therapy focuses on building a supportive, nonjudgmental space where clients can explore emotions, decisions, and relationship concerns at their own pace. It can be especially helpful when someone feels overwhelmed, stuck, or unsure of the next step.
Mindfulness Therapy brings attention to present-moment experience - thoughts, feelings, and body cues - so stress and anxiety become more manageable and less consuming. It can support clients who want to respond more intentionally, rather than feeling pulled around by worry or pressure. Motivational Interviewing adds a collaborative, goal-focused style that helps resolve ambivalence, strengthen commitment to change, and translate insight into action during life transitions or times of uncertainty.
